EBRD signs €50m risk-sharing facility with Turkish bank TSKB

Region:
Europe

Turkish businesses will have greater access to finance under a new agreement between the European Bank for Reconstruction and Development and Turkiye Sinai Kalkinma Bankasi (TSKB). The EBRD is providing a risk-sharing facility of €50 million which – together with TSKB resources...
